2008-10-17 15 views
7

मैं ऐसे समाधान के साथ आने की कोशिश कर रहा हूं कि उपयोगकर्ता वेब-सेवा का यूआरएल दर्ज करने जा रहा है और इसका परीक्षण किया जा रहा है।क्या रन-टाइम में वेब रेफरेंस के गुणों को बदलना संभव है?

हालांकि जो भी मैं चाहता हूं वह एक यूआरएल परिवर्तन है, मैं गारंटी देता हूं कि सेवा विवरण हमेशा एक जैसा होगा (wsdl: पाठ्यक्रम के सेवा टैग जिसमें साबुन: पता है) को छोड़कर; मैं सिर्फ एक ही सेवा चलाने, विभिन्न ग्राहकों का परीक्षण करना चाहता हूं।

+0

यह पहला सवाल मैं इतना पर पूछा है है। यह 17 अक्टूबर 2008 को वापस आता है। पहले पूछे जाने वाले सवाल को 8 जून 2010 को पूछा गया था। मुझे लगता है कि यह सवाल डुप्लिकेट नहीं है, दूसरा है। – tafa

उत्तर

7

हाँ आप कर सकते हैं। किसी भी तरीके से कॉल करने से पहले बस सेवा प्रॉक्सी की यूआरएल संपत्ति बदलें।

+0

ओह, मेरे। मुझे बस एक उदाहरण था, जो मैं देख रहा था वह प्रकार था। – tafa

3

हां; प्रत्येक वेब-सेवा प्रॉक्सी ऐसा करने का एक तरीका प्रदान करती है; प्री-डब्ल्यूसीएफ प्रॉक्सी (डब्लूएसईएक्स समेत) के साथ पता प्रॉक्सी क्लास पर Url संपत्ति है - प्रॉक्सी के साथ कुछ भी दिलचस्प करने से पहले इसे बदलें।

डब्ल्यूसीएफ के साथ, मेरा मानना ​​है कि आप रचनाकारों में से एक के माध्यम से एंडपॉइंट-पता निर्दिष्ट करते हैं।

तो बस अपने संदर्भ wsdl से आपके प्रॉक्सी उत्पन्न, और आप बंद ;-p जाना